/*
 * Support note: as of the Quillbrook payroll release, the export
 * format for Ostergard Staffing changed from fixed-width to
 * delimited records, and downstream banks now reject files with
 * the old column ordering. If a customer reports a rejected
 * payroll file, first confirm which format version their tenant
 * is pinned to before escalating. Re-exports are safe; the job
 * is idempotent per pay period. The module constants governing
 * format selection and field widths are listed below.
 */

constants for tageg-kagag:
QUOTAS = {
    "kelax": 495,
    "istath": 366,
    "tammir": 108,
    "novdor": 730,
    "casax": 816,
    "quenael": 874,
    "pelius": 403,
}

## Authentication

The Ledgerloom reconciliation job runs nightly against the Stockbarn inventory service. It authenticates using a service-scoped API key with read-only access to stock snapshots and write access to the discrepancy table. Keys are rotated quarterly by the platform team. For local development against the sandbox environment, use the key provided below.

app token of yajeg-kawef = kto11_7En3XSX8xQw

## Wayfield TilePrefetch — Build Provenance

Welcome aboard. Every TilePrefetch artifact is produced by the hermetic build pipeline: sources are pinned by digest, dependencies come from the internal mirror, and the runner image is immutable per release. Never install a binary shared out-of-band; provenance cannot be verified for those. To confirm an artifact, match its manifest against the release ledger and check the attached signature. Each ledger entry records the exact build under the token shown below.

trace token, fafog-kageg: htk4_98e6

2025-03-12 — Key rotation, ChipGate reader fleet.

Rotated signing material for the Striderline marathon timing-chip readers after the old key passed its expiry window. All readers at the Velbury course re-enrolled cleanly; two units required a manual reflash. Old key revoked in the provisioning service. Firmware pushes now verify against the new key, recorded here:

release key, fajef-kajeg: bky19_LdLu6Ne6FLi8he2c24d